What: SARRC Walkerville running group.
When: Thursdays at 5:50am for a 6:00am start. Where: 39 Smith St, Walkerville (YMCA car park). See google map. Who: All runners, beginner to experienced. Map Instructions
Smartphone:
You can view the maps on your smartphone while you're running - a dot will show your location on the map.

- Tap on the route name - if you're on a smartphone select "go to mobile version" and wait for the map to load.
- On the map, tap on the "full screen" icon (broken square on top left, just below the zoom buttons +/-)
- Tap on the "show my position" icon (arrow, just below the full screen icon) - select "OK" if your phone asks permission to use your location.
- Optional: The most uncluttered map is "Mapquest". To show, tap on the "paper stack" icon (top right hand side) and select "Mapquest".
- Zoom in/out by pinching the map.
GPX File with smartphone app:
You can download the map files (GPX) and use a smartphone app which will give a better experience than the above method. There's a link to download the GPX file on each of the above maps. The Trail running SA "Recommeded way" has more information.
